Panhandlers
Atlanta, as in most cities of any size, has a population of homeless and panhandlers. It is likely that an attendee at the Intel ISEF will be approached as they move from their hotel to various event locations with requests for financial contributions. These individuals, quite often will present imaginative and compelling stories as to why they need your money. The city of Atlanta offers the homeless and persons in need multiple levels of support including housing, food and other necessities. The ambassadors suggest that when attendees are approached by panhandlers, that they continue to walk toward their destination by politely saying “No”. Any conversation beyond a simple “No” is perceived by the panhandler as encouragement. In the rare situation where the panhandler persists on accompanying you as you walk, the attendee may simply signal a nearby ambassador. As mentioned above, ambassadors are stationed every block or two along the recommended walking pathways. (See above)A common panhandler strategy is to volunteer assistance with directions. The ambassadors recommend that attendees politely refuse this offer of assistance. One of the purposes of the ambassadors is to provide information and directions to nearby restaurants, hotels, and other neighborhood venues.

Street Safety

  • When possible, travel with another person when sightseeing or shopping, particularly at night. 
  • Be aware of your surroundings and trust your instincts. Do not feel embarrassed to leave an uncomfortable situation.
  • Walk with purpose and project an assertive and business-like image. Criminals will be discouraged if you do not appear vulnerable or easily intimidated.
    When asking for directions, first look for a police officer or another public employee (i.e., bus driver), or go into a nearby business.
  • Do not carry large amounts of cash. Use traveler's checks and debit cards. Keep a record of traveler's check numbers, credit card numbers, photocopy of passport and other valuable documents separate from originals.
  • If you must carry a large amount of cash, separate it from your purse or wallet and carry it inside clothing (i.e., in a hidden pocket or a money belt).
  • Be careful and alert when cashing traveler's checks, or using a cash machine. Never let someone see how much money you have in your wallet, or where you keep your money.
  • Don't wear expensive jewelry and watches when out sightseeing. If you must wear it, wear it inside your clothing.
  • Pickpockets are often attracted to crowded places. They often work in teams of two or three; one may create a distraction while the other one lifts your wallet. Be aware of someone who bumps, shoves or gets too close.
  • Don't tempt a thief by leaving your purse or wallet unattended. It only takes a second to grab it.
  • Learn to carry your purse or wallet safely. Purses should be closed, held in front of your body, with your arm across it. Wallets should be carried a front pants pocket or in an interior jacket pocket.

Hotel Safety
  • Don’t answer the door in a hotel or motel room without verifying who it is. If a person claims to be an employee, call the front desk and ask if someone from their staff is supposed to have access to your room and for what purpose.
  • When returning to your hotel or motel late in the evening, use the main entrance of the hotel. Be observant and look around before entering parking lots.
  • Close the door securely whenever you are in your room and use all of the locking devices provided.
  • Don’t needlessly display guestroom keys or convention badges in public.
  • Don’t invite strangers to your room.
  • Place all valuables in the hotel or motel’s safe deposit box.
  • Do not leave valuables in your vehicle.
  • Check to see that any sliding glass doors or windows and any connecting room doors are locked.
  • If you see any suspicious activity, please report your observations to the management.
